This was my 6th exam and I felt it was the most difficult to study for and felt the exam was the most difficult of the ones taken thus far. The vignette on the other hand was among the easiest. In all, I studied for about 4 weeks. focused mostly on Marc Mitalski's course and supplemented it with the FEMA 454, BDCS review and Mikes notes. Mitalski's videos were great and more importantly, I felt his practice questions and explanations were what prepared me the most. I practiced all of his questions at least twice and would try three or four times until I could get the questions right. I did not try the thaddeus course so I cannot compare the two. I chose Mitalski because of the practice questions and the cost was much less.

The test was difficult and math intensive, I recommend knowing the principles behind the formulas, when to use them and how the formulas inter-relate to each other. It was important for me to memorize all of the main formulas. As soon as the exam started, I wrote them down on the scratch paper and referenced them throughout the exam; others recommended this approach and I found it helpful.
